Easy Cranberry Sauce Everyone Will Absolutely Love

  • Total Time: 17 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ings 1x
  • Diet: Gluten Free

Description

This easy cranberry sauce recipe is sweet, tart, and ready in under 20 minutes. Perfect for holidays and everyday meals alike.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 12 oz fresh cranberries
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up orange juice
  • 1/2 cup water
  • Optional: Orange zest, cinnamon stick, v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Combine Ingredients: In a medium saucepan, mix cranberries, sugar, orange juice, and water.
  2. Boil: Bring to a boil over medium-high heat.
  3. Simmer: Reduce heat and simmer 10–12 minutes until cranberries burst.
  4. Flavor: Add optional zest or spices and stir well.
  5. Cool: Remove from heat. Let cool completely.
  6. Serve or Store: Serve warm or chilled. Refrigerate leftovers.

Notes

  • Add more sugar for sweeter results.
  • Use honey or maple syrup for a natural twist.
  • Can be made 3–5 days ahead.
